What is MPH?
MPH stands for Miles Per Hour, a unit of speed commonly used in countries like the United States and the United Kingdom. It measures how many miles are covered in one hour.
For example:
- 60 MPH means traveling 60 miles in one hour
- 30 MPH means traveling 30 miles in one hour
The MPH Calculator helps convert distance and time into this standard speed unit.
Formula Used in MPH Calculator
The core formula behind the MPH Calculator is simple:
Speed (MPH) = Distance (Miles) ÷ Time (Hours)
Where:
- Distance is measured in miles
- Time is measured in hours
- Speed is the result in miles per hour
If time is given in minutes or seconds, it must first be converted into hours before applying the formula.
Conversions:
- Minutes to hours = minutes ÷ 60
- Seconds to hours = seconds ÷ 3600

Practical Examples of MPH Calculation
Example 1: Driving Speed
A car travels 150 miles in 3 hours.
Speed = 150 ÷ 3 = 50 MPH
So, the vehicle’s speed is 50 miles per hour.
Example 2: Cycling Speed
A cyclist covers 30 miles in 2 hours.
Speed = 30 ÷ 2 = 15 MPH
The cyclist’s average speed is 15 MPH.
Example 3: Running Speed
A runner completes 5 miles in 0.5 hours (30 minutes).
Speed = 5 ÷ 0.5 = 10 MPH
The runner’s speed is 10 MPH.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
While using the MPH Calculator, users should avoid:
- Entering distance in incorrect units (kilometers instead of miles)
- Using minutes or seconds without converting to hours
- Misreading results as instant speed instead of average speed
- Ignoring rest or stop time in real-life travel
Understanding these mistakes ensures more accurate results.
